Marching Orders

Jesus is King and we as men or Knights of the 21st Century have been called to follow His commands and serve as He sees fit. What are our King's marching orders? It is required of those of us that follow Christ to reflect God's presence in our life. Jesus, as our King, in Luke 10:27 clearly states our marching orders. We, as men, have been called to love! God has called us to love Him with all of our heart, soul, and mind and our neighbor as ourselves. This is a pretty big challenge when you think about it.
How are we, as men, doing so far in accomplishing the task assigned to us by our King? It doesn't take long, when you look at the full capacity of our prisons, the level of male violence in our culture, and the number of women and children that are in recovery, due to male actions, to understand that there are a lot of males who have chosen not to become men and follow the King.
